Output b1dd93d1601487c7596366028a8480b6576bb4747f626b22e1c5d3d3a446f17f:17

value
65770551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a59c0ecd0f51aaf0832960bf878d8b02e918a6a7 OP_EQUALVERIFY OP_CHECKSIG
address
1G6fSjsfeyV9EEHnDmDP5aPcWYzFjdgT6e
transaction
b1dd93d1601487c7596366028a8480b6576bb4747f626b22e1c5d3d3a446f17f
confirmations
520496
spent
true